HALLOWEEN VEGETABLE TRAY WITCH WITH HERB DIP

This cute-but slightly scary!-witch is easy to construct (no special tools needed) and sits in the center of a fun, healthy Halloween snack or appetizer. We've given some crudité options here to round out the platter, but feel free to use whatever raw vegetables you like. The creamy green dip can be made a day ahead.

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Categories     appetizer

Time 40m

Yield 8 servings

Number Of Ingredients 21



Halloween Vegetable Tray Witch with Herb Dip image

Steps:

  • For the herb dip: Combine the spinach, parsley, scallions, dill, lemon juice and olive oil in a food processor and process until smooth. Add the sour cream, cream cheese, 1 teaspoon salt and a generous amount of black pepper. Process to make a smooth dip. Transfer to a serving bowl and refrigerate while you make the veggie witch, or refrigerate up to 1 day.
  • For the vegetable witch: Bring a large pot of salted water to boil and prepare an ice bath. Add the asparagus to the boiling water and simmer until bright green, about 2 minutes. Transfer to the ice bath to cool. Remove with a slotted spoon and pat dry. Add the green beans to the boiling water and simmer until bright green, about 2 minutes. Transfer to the ice bath to cool. Remove with a slotted spoon and pat dry.
  • Set a large cutting board or platter on the counter with the short side closest to you. Arrange the broccoli florets in an inverted triangle on the lower half of the cutting board to make the witch's face. Add the radish slices for eyes and top with the cherry tomato slices for eyeballs. Add a spinach leaf right above each eye for eyebrows. Cut a 2-inch length from the pointy end of the carrot for the nose then cut a thin slice from the remaining piece of carrot on the bias for the mouth and arrange both pieces on the face.
  • Arrange the green beans, pointy side down, on each side of the face for hair. Arrange the longest asparagus spears in a triangle shape at the top of the face for the witch's hat. Trim the remaining spears and arrange on the top left of the hat to make a crooked point for the hat.
  • Gather the microgreens or arugula at the top of the face for bangs. Arrange the cucumber slices horizontally over top to make the brim of the hat so the bangs stick out. Cut a thin lengthwise slice from the carrot and trim to make a band for the hat. Set the baby bell pepper slice in the middle to make a buckle.
  • Arrange the rainbow baby carrots, celery and cauliflower around the witch to fill in the platter. Serve with the dip.

3 cups loosely packed baby spinach
1 cup loosely packed fresh Italian parsley leaves
2 scallions, trimmed and chopped
1/4 cup loosely packed fresh dill fronds
2 tablespoons fresh lemon juice
2 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il
1 cup sour cream
4 ounces cream cheese, at room temperature
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per
Kosher salt
1 bunch thin asparagus, tough stems trimmed
4 ounces green beans, stem end trimmed
1 head broccoli, separated into small florets
2 thin slices radish
2 thin slices cherry tomato
2 very small baby spinach leaves
1 purple carrot, peeled
Handful microgreens or baby arugula
3 Persian cucumbers, sliced crosswise
1 thin crosswise slice baby bell pepper slice
Rainbow baby carrots, celery sticks, cauliflower florets or your favorite veggies, for dipping

SKELETON VEGGIES AND DIP

Clever arrangement of fresh veggies form this skeleton and makes a clever twist on hummus and crudites.

Provided by Dixie®

Time 20m

Yield 6

Number Of Ingredients 8



Skeleton Veggies and Dip image

Steps:

  • Down the center of a large cutting board, or tray, place some cucumber slices to form the spine of the skeleton. Arrange some red pepper strips on both sides of the cucumbers to form a rib cage.
  • Around the base of the cucumber slices, place some cauliflower florets to form a pelvis. Use celery sticks to form the legs of the skeleton, and cauliflower florets to form the knee joints. At the base of each leg, place a broccoli floret for feet.
  • Use baby carrots to form the shoulders and arms of the skeleton, using remaining broccoli florets for hands.
  • Into a small glass bowl or ramekin, spoon the hummus. Place at the top of the skeleton to make the head. Arrange the lettuce leaf around top of the bowl to form the hair. On hummus, place carrot slices to form the eyes and a red pepper slice for the mouth. Keep refrigerated until ready to serve.
  • Serve remaining vegetables alongside the skeleton as dippers.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 111.2 calories, Carbohydrate 13.8 g, Fat 4.8 g, Fiber 5.2 g, Protein 5.3 g, SaturatedFat 0.7 g, Sodium 219.1 mg, Sugar 3.5 g

1 cucumber, sliced
1 medium red sweet pepper - halved, seeded, and cut crosswise into strips
1 cup cauliflower florets
2 stalks celery, cut into bite-size 1/2-inch-wide strips
1 cup broccoli florets
1 cup baby carrots
1 (10 ounce) container hummus
1 leaf romaine lettuce
